What is a Paid Training job?

A Paid Training job is a position where employees receive compensation while undergoing training for a specific role or skill. This can include on-the-job training, classroom instruction, or a combination of both. Employers use paid training to prepare new hires or upskill current employees without requiring them to cover training costs. These jobs are common in industries like sales, customer service, healthcare, and skilled trades. The goal is to ensure employees are fully equipped to perform their duties effectively.

What can I expect during the paid training period in terms of daily activities and support?

During paid training, you can expect a structured blend of classroom learning, hands-on practice, and mentorship from experienced colleagues or supervisors. Daily activities may include attending lectures, participating in group workshops, completing practice tasks, and receiving regular feedback to track your progress. Many companies provide dedicated trainers or onboarding specialists to answer questions and guide you through learning modules. This supportive environment is designed to equip you with the essential knowledge and skills needed to excel in your future position, ensuring a smooth transition into the job.

As a Registered Dietitian at DaVita, you'll be a part of a Team that values work-life balance and where your personal and professional growth is a top priority.

DaVita has an open position for a Registered Dietitian who will be a vital member of each patient's core care team. You will analyze lab-work results and educate patients-and their families-on what to eat accordingly. Your ability to influence and lead will be critical to helping them live better lives. If you love patient-centered health care and knowing patients on a personal level-now is your time to explore your next journey-at DaVita.

What you can expect:

  • Build meaningful and long-term relationships with patients and their families in an intimate outpatient setting.

  • Be a part of a Team that appreciates, supports and relies on each other in a positive environment.

  • Performance-based rewards based on stellar individual and team contributions.

Requirements:

  • State licensure required if licensure is available in the state where the facility is located

  • Bachelor's degree in Nutrition, Dietetics, or similar area required

  • Ability to work flexible schedules, possibly for multiple facilities and travel when needed

  • After hire and training, successful completion of the Competency Assessment for Renal Dietitians (CARD) with a score of at least 80% required

  • Intermediate computer skills and proficiency with MS Word, Excel, and Outlook required as well as functional proficiency with DaVita specific applications within 60 days

DaVita is a healthcare company that provides compassionate, quality healthcare. The company’s mission is to be the Provider, Partner, and Employer of Choice. DaVita serves more than 200,000 dialysis patients in 10 countries outside the U.S. and has over 55,000 teammates in the U.S. Since 2011, DaVita teammates have donated $11 million to local nonprofits and have volunteered over 180,000 hours since 2006. DaVita has been on Fortune’s list of the world’s most admired companies for 15 years in a row.
